    Ingredients

    The ingredients needed to make Candied Bacon Apple Roast:

    1. Make ready 2 pound pork roast
    2. Make ready Pack bacon
    3. Prepare brown sugar
    4. Get 1 apple
    5. Prepare black pepper
    6. Take 1 tbsp butter

    Instructions

    Steps to make Candied Bacon Apple Roast:

    1. Cut 3 large slits into the roast. not all the way through but just over half way
    2. Slice an apple into thin slices
    3. Place a few apple slices in the cuts on the meat
    4. Wrap in bacon Note: you can actually feel your cholesterol rising during this step.
    5. Add some black pepper then add brown sugar. Its easier if you just take the sugar in your hand and press in into the meat so it sticks.
    6. Bake at 300 for about 2 hours
    7. Take the tablespoon of butter and put it on the center top of the roast with a clump of brown sugar on top of it. This adds a bit of a finishing glaze
    8. Once butter melts remove from oven and swat 6 year olds hand away while warning "its still hot obviosly…you litterally just watch me pulled it out of the oven"
    9. Use tongs to hold it while you slice it
